I've had this avic. metallica for almost a year now and she's always been a very picky eater, but slowly she's become less and less interested in feeding. She seems to enjoy faster prey, so I give her red runners, but even then, if she misses, she loses interest.

Is it common for avics to be this picky? She's a little thin and could definitely plump up a lot more, and I'm just hoping I'll be able to get her there some day.

How big is she? Could be that the prey is too big and the initial interest is more of a defensive strike.

If not try killing the roach and leaving it on her web to scavenge overnight
